
宝塔面板作为一个功能强大的服务器管理工具,提供了直观易用的界面,极大简化了MySQL数据库的更新流程
本文将详细介绍如何在宝塔面板中更新MySQL数据库,确保操作既高效又安全
一、前期准备:备份数据库 在进行任何数据库升级之前,首要步骤是备份现有数据库
这一步至关重要,因为升级过程中可能会出现不可预见的问题,导致数据丢失或损坏
宝塔面板提供了便捷的数据库备份功能,具体操作如下: 1.登录宝塔面板:在浏览器中输入宝塔面板的地址,使用您的账号和密码登录
2.进入数据库管理页面:在宝塔面板首页,找到并点击左侧导航栏中的“数据库”菜单,然后选择“MySQL管理”
3.选择并备份数据库:在MySQL管理页面,找到需要更新的MySQL实例,点击其右侧的“管理”按钮
进入该数据库的管理页面后,点击“备份数据库”按钮
根据需要选择备份类型(完整备份或仅备份结构),并填写备份备注,最后点击“备份”按钮完成备份操作
二、更新MySQL版本 宝塔面板提供了两种主要的MySQL更新方式:一种是直接通过宝塔界面进行在线更新,另一种是手动下载升级包并上传至服务器进行更新
下面将分别介绍这两种方法
方法一:在线更新MySQL 1.进入MySQL管理页面:登录宝塔面板后,点击左侧导航栏的“数据库”菜单,然后选择“MySQL管理”
2.选择需要更新的MySQL实例:在MySQL管理页面,找到并点击需要更新的MySQL实例右侧的“管理”按钮
3.点击更新按钮:在MySQL实例的管理页面,找到并点击“更新”按钮
宝塔面板会自动检测可用的MySQL版本,并列出供选择的版本列表
4.选择并确定更新版本:在弹出的版本选择框中,选择您希望更新的MySQL版本,然后点击“确定”按钮
更新过程需要一些时间,请耐心等待
5.验证更新结果:更新完成后,宝塔面板会自动重启MySQL服务以使新版本生效
您可以在数据库管理页面查看更新日志,确保更新过程没有出现错误或警告
同时,访问网站并测试数据库功能,以确保升级成功
方法二:手动下载升级包并上传更新 对于希望更灵活地控制更新过程的用户,可以选择手动下载MySQL升级包并上传至服务器进行更新
具体步骤如下: 1.下载MySQL升级包:在MySQL官方网站或宝塔面板的“版本管理”页面下载最新版本的MySQL升级包
2.上传升级包:登录宝塔面板后,进入需要更新的MySQL实例的管理页面
在“版本管理”一栏,点击“升级”按钮
在弹出的对话框中点击“选择文件”,选择之前下载的MySQL升级包文件,然后点击“上传”按钮开始上传升级包
3.执行升级操作:上传完升级包后,点击“执行升级”按钮开始执行MySQL数据库的升级操作
升级过程可能需要一些时间,请耐心等待
4.验证并恢复数据库:升级完成后,同样需要在数据库管理页面查看升级日志,确保升级过程没有出现错误或警告
然后,将之前备份的数据库数据导入新版本的MySQL中
可以使用宝塔面板的“恢复”功能,选择之前备份的文件并点击“恢复”按钮开始恢复数据库
5.测试数据库功能:升级并恢复数据库后,使用宝塔面板提供的PHPMyAdmin等工具登录到MySQL,检查数据库是否能够正常访问和操作
三、注意事项与最佳实践 1.选择合适的更新时机:由于数据库升级可能会影响网站的正常访问,建议在业务低峰期进行升级操作,以减少对用户的影响
2.详细阅读升级说明:在升级前,仔细阅读MySQL的升级说明和宝塔面板的更新日志,了解新版本的功能变化、兼容性以及可能存在的已知问题
3.充分测试:升级完成后,进行全面的测试以确保新版本的MySQL数据库能够正常工作
测试内容包括数据库连接、SQL语句执行、性能等方面
4.保持备份习惯:定期备份数据库是数据库管理的最佳实践之一
即使在升级成功后,也应保留最近的备份文件,以便在需要时能够快速恢复数据
5.监控与日志分析:升级后,利用宝塔面板的监控功能和MySQL的日志分析功能,持续关注数据库的运行状态和性能表现
一旦发现异常,及时采取措施进行处理
四、总结 通过宝塔面板更新MySQL数据库是一个相对简单且高效的过程
无论是选择在线更新还是手动下载升级包进行更新,都需要在升级前做好充分的准备工作,特别是数据备份工作
在升级过程中,要仔细阅读升级说明和宝塔面板的更新日志,了解新版本的变化和可能存在的问题
升级完成后,进行全面的测试以确保数据库能够正常工作
同时,保持备份习惯和监控日志分析也是数据库管理中的重要环节
通过遵循这些步骤和最佳实践,您可以轻松地在宝塔面板中更新MySQL数据库,提升数据库性能和安全性
隐藏CMD中的MySQL运行信息技巧
宝塔面板快速更新MySQL指南
Mysql+JSP服务器:构建数据库交互桥梁
掌握MySQL Before触发器:数据操作前的自动化魔法
Zabbix自动发现监控MySQL实战指南
MySQL不区分大小写设置技巧
MySQL数据高效导入Impala指南
MySQL技巧:快速显示前8条数据
安装MySQL后,快速测试方法指南
Eclipse中快速连接MySQL数据库教程
一键操作:如何快速删除MySQL数据库中所有表
JFinal快速配置MySQL数据库指南
IIS7上快速配置MySQL指南
Linux系统快速搭建MySQL指南
快速上手:启用MySQL数据库教程
Python脚本快速删除MySQL数据库
MySQL索引优化:快速计算经纬度距离
MySQL宕机快速重启指南
Navicat助力:MySQL快速建表指南